A successful, thriving dental practice needs a loyal patient base. Without people to treat, there is no business to run. This sounds ridiculously obvious, but sometimes it’s easy to lose sight of what your patients really want and need. You may be inspired by the new techniques, equipment and materials on offer, but these benefits have to be meaningful to your patients too, so that they not only choose your practice, but then remain loyal.

Loyal, happy patients spread positive word of mouth recommendations, which strengthen your brand and reputation – and keeps your bottom line healthy. If you are going to succeed and thrive, high-quality, high-tech care must run alongside a patient based that is nurtured, while you find ways to ethically drive up new business. Many practices find this an ongoing challenge – after all, patients know an alternative is just a click or call away.
